Is almorzar irregular?

Notice that almorzar is irregular in some verbal tenses, so in the singular and the third person plural, the stem vowel o changes into ue.

Is almorzar a word?

In Spanish, there is a very specific verb to refer to the action of "having lunch" or "eating lunch", and that is almorzar. Although many Spanish speakers tend to use comer (to eat) when talking about meals, almorzar is the word you want to use for a mid-day meal.

How do you form the preterit in Spanish?

The preterite is the most common way to talk about the past in Spanish. To form the preterite of regular -ar verbs, take off the -ar ending and add the endings: -é, -aste, -ó, -amos, -asteis, -aron.

Is Fui ser or IR?

In this lesson, you learned how to conjugate the verbs ser and estar in the preterite tense. Ser was easy because, even though it is irregular in the preterite, it is exactly the same as the verb ir (to go): fui, fuiste, fue, fuimos, fuisteis, fueron.

Is fue a preterite?

1. “Era” is the imperfect tense of the Spanish verb “ser” while “fue” is its preterite tense. 2. “Era” is used to describe how things were or how a person was while “fue” is used to narrate an event that happened in the past and how it happened.
